About REI

REI is a retail company that specializes in outdoor recreation gear and clothing. The company was founded in 1938 by Lloyd and Mary Anderson in Seattle, Washington. REI is a consumer cooperative, meaning that it is owned by its members and operates for their benefit. The company has over 170 stores in the United States and is known for its commitment to environmental stewardship and sustainability. REI has been recognized as one of the best companies to work for in the United States.
